ClockShark Vs. Paycom payroll Services
ClockShark: For field service and construction companies who want to get rid of paper time sheets, ClockShark is the GPS time tracking and scheduling app that is both powerful and easy to use. ClockShark makes payroll painless and accurate. It also makes getting schedules to employees in the field fast and easy.
Paycom payroll Services: Regardless of the complexity of your current processes, we can streamline payroll and HR into one online application. See for yourself why Paycom’s technology has made us the fastest growing payroll company in the country.
Who is more expensive? ClockShark or Paycom?
The real total cost of ownership (TCO) of Time-sheet entry software includes the software license, subscription fees, software training, customizations, hardware (if needed), maintenance and support and other related services. When calculating the TCO, it's important to add all of these ”hidden costs” as well. We prepared a TCO (Total Cost) calculator for ClockShark and Paycom.
ClockShark price starts at $3 per user/month , On a scale between 1 to 10 ClockShark is rated 4, which is lower than the average cost of Time-sheet entry software. Paycom price starts at $195.67 per license , When comparing Paycom to its competitors, the software is rated 6 - similar to the average Time-sheet entry software cost.
Bottom line: Paycom is more expensive than ClockShark.

Target customer size
ClockShark's typical customers include: SMBs, and Paycom's target customer size include: Medium and large size businesses.
